Editing reports

With the appropriate access rights, you can edit predefined as well as custom reports and save them as custom reports. If you have little or no experience with creating new reports with Microsoft Power BI, we recommend that you edit a predefined report and save it as a copy.

Note

You can cancel editing mode at any time by selecting the Cancel edit entry from the dropdown menu .

How to edit a report

To edit a report, proceed as follows:

  1. Open the report you wish to edit.
  2. Select , located at the top-right corner. A dropdown menu will then appear.
  3. Select Edit.
  4. The Edit function in octoplant pro hub uses Microsoft Power BI to provide a data visualization and business intelligence. There is the option to add additional filters, visualizations, fields and other customizations as required.
  5. Make your changes as required.
  6. To save your changes, select the Save menu entry from the File menu in the top-left corner of the report.

Symbol_note_pinned.png You cannot modify and save predefined reports directly, you can only create a copy of them and save it under Custom Reports. In this case, the File menu contains only the Save as entry.

Note

If you are not satisfied with the changes you have made to a report, you can reset the report by selecting the Reset_Report_Icon.png icon in the top-right corner of the report.

  1. Your report has now been updated.
  2. Select located at the top-right corner, then Exit edit mode from the dropdown menu.
